Transaction 531ad38fe6ecff49a3cebe02bb5a19d9bcbcbaf51a78f0fd678f36304da14920
2 Input
2 Outputs
- 531ad38fe6ecff49a3cebe02bb5a19d9bcbcbaf51a78f0fd678f36304da14920:0
- 531ad38fe6ecff49a3cebe02bb5a19d9bcbcbaf51a78f0fd678f36304da14920:1
value 16853469
address 1Gwzm4wQZQMXPgRog3iZqsYYbYs21KSsAj
value 786422
address 1E6855XupM1WZQT6yoj2Kwf1xao3qc97DW